Transaction 8ac876f73c13815e633b9cea4977d733040768b296486a0e79632e85e5198873
1 Input
1 Output
-
8ac876f73c13815e633b9cea4977d733040768b296486a0e79632e85e5198873:0
- value
- 1354553
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f0b589edeec83146c4bac7aac478c2ea0f12668
- address
- bc1qpu9438k7ajp3gmzt43a2c3uv96s0zfngvr7l09